I understand that OneCare 1.5 has anti-spyware functunailty built in (but has
no references to Windows Defender) - am I gaining any benefit by installing
Defender (i.e. joining the Spynet community reporting etc)?
 
B

Bill Sanderson MVP

I believe that the equivalent of Windows Defender is built-in to OneCare
1.5--i.e. the integration is more complete.

I can't say that it's the same code, but it may be. I would stick with
OneCare if you are running it.
